Top 5 Luxury Cars of 2009
NADAguides.com just came out with their Top 5 Luxury Cars for 2009 report. The five exceptionally honoured vehicles are: 2009 Audi A8 L, 2009 Jaguar XF Supercharged, 2009 Mercedes-Benz S Class 550, 2009 Hyundai Genesis, and 2009 Bentley Arnage.
Weird part about this ‘luxury’ car report is that cars such as the 2009 Hyundai Genesis starts at $32,250. Has the bar for ‘luxury’ dropped or has the world become so poor that $32,250 now seems like a luxurious price?
Every car on the Top 5 list except the Bentley starts at a price less than $100,000. And, starting at $224,900 Bentley was actually fifth of the Top 5 luxury cars. Apparently you don’t need to pay too much to be in the lap of luxury any longer.
Hyundai Genesis would definitely have to be the crème-de-la-crème of value for money, as it was even up against the Porsche Boxster and the BMW 750i for the prestigious placement in the Top 5 rankings.
